Cần học hỏi 1 số gì để là một thiết kế web

Discussion in 'Các mặt hàng khác' started by linhvetinh1, Aug 18, 2016.

  1. linhvetinh1

    linhvetinh1 Thần Tài

    Động lực trợ giúp cho người lập trình viên chính là 1 số niềm vui và ham mê trong công Vấn đề lập trình, điều này sẽ khiến người lập trình viên thiết kế website cảm thấy dễ chịu và nhiều năng lượng hơn trong ngành công nghiệp IT khá khô khan. dù vậy để giữ đc sự say mê đấy mãi mãi thì mọi người phải trở thành một người lập trình viên giỏi và bước đầu chính là phải học từ một số thứ căn bản.
    những điều tôi nói ở trên chẳng phải là một câu thần chú để các bạn có khả năng theo đó mà phát triển thành một lập trình viên giỏi mà quan trọng là tôi sẽ đưa ra 1 số Mẹo hữu ích để các bạn lớn mạnh đc trong ngày công nghiệp này. Nội dung chủ đề sau tôi sẽ kể vài kiểu lập trình viên mà đã tăng trưởng ra vài giải pháp IT lý tưởng và góp phần làm cho cả ngành công nghiệp này tăng trưởng, chứ tôi ko đề ra một khái niệm về lập trình viên giỏi.
    [​IMG]
    1. Phải học từ các thứ căn bản nhất thiết kế website trọn gói giá rẻ
    điều đó luôn đúng với bất kỳ lĩnh vực nào, lúc các bạn hiểu rõ mọi mọi thứ ở mức khái niệm thì đó là chìa khóa của sự thành công. Một người lập trình mà ko có nền tảng kiến thức căn bản vững chắc thì ko bao giờ có thể trở thành một nhà lập trình viên giỏi. Thực trạng hiểu được 1 vài khái niệm cốt lõi sẽ giúp đỡ bạn trong Vấn đề thiết kế và thực thi 1 số phương án theo Cách tốt nhất có khả năng. nếu như tự mọi người hiện cảm thấy mình thiếu 1 số nền tảng về khoa học máy tính và một số khái niệm trong ngôn ngữ lập trình mà bạn hiện sử dụng, thì hãy quay trở lại học ngay một số điều căn bản nhất.
    2. Luôn đặt ra các vấn đề thắc mắc (Tại sao? Như thế nào?) với toàn bộ đoạn code mà mọi người viết ra thiết kế web giới thiệu doanh nghiệp
    Có một thứ mà tôi thấy là từ ấy nó sẽ làm ra một ranh giới cụ thể rõ ràng giữa một vài lập trình viên giỏi và phần còn lại, đó chính là sự khao khát muốn biết lý do tại sao và đoạn code đấy sẽ chạy như thế nào? một vài ít lập trình viên sẽ chẳng bao giờ chịu chuyển sang tác vụ tiếp theo nếu như vẫn chưa hiểu rõ đoạn code mà mình viết ra sẽ làm theo thế nào. ko phải khi nào chúng ta cũng có điều kiện để làm điều đấy vì chúng ta còn bị giới hạn của thời gian kết thúc dự án, Bởi thế nhiều khi viết ra một số đoạn code mà ta chỉ hiểu đc qua loa rằng nó sẽ phục vụ đc yêu cầu công Thực trạng như thế nào. dù vậy để trở thành một lập trình viên giỏi thì mọi người hãy luôn thử nghiên cứu ở mức sâu nhất có thể. điều ấy dần dần sẽ phát triển thành một thói quen và sau ấy các bạn sẽ thực hiện nó một Hướng dẫn liên tục mà không biết.
    3. Có nhiều thứ các bạn sẽ làm được trong lúc giúp người khác.
    phần lớn ai trong chúng ta cũng đều có khuynh hướng là chỉ nhảy bổ vào một số diễn đàn và các trang hỏi đáp trên mạng lúc chúng ta cần sự hỗ trợ. Từ Thực trạng này chúng ta có thể biết những ai là lập trình viên giỏi so cùng với phần còn lại vì nếu như là lập trình viên giỏi thì họ sẽ hay vào một vài trang web để giúp đỡ bạn còn phần còn lại thì chỉ biết hỏi lúc có hạn chế khúc mắc. lúc giúp một ai đấy sẽ khiến họ bắt đầu đc cao hơn. Cũng như trong một nhóm học Vấn đề , mọi người hãy giúp những người khác giải quyết những hạn chế của họ. mọi người sẽ có thêm được nhiều Mẹo trong công Vấn đề cũng như đời sống của mình qua Vấn đề mọi người hiểu đc một vài hạn chế mà người khác gặp phải trong hoàn cảnh của họ.
    4. Hãy viết ra những đoạn code đơn giản, dễ hiểu và có logic
    Công thức KISS- "Keep it simple and short – Giữ cho mọi thứ đc ngắn gọn và đơn giản" luôn đúng đắn với tất cả thứ trong cuộc sống và công Việc lập trình cũng ko ngoại lệ. Hãy viết 1 vài đoạn code có logic và tránh sự phức tạp. có đôi lúc người ta viết ra một vài đoạn code phức tạp chỉ để chứng tỏ trình độ của họ là có khả năng viết ra một vài đoạn code như vậy. Kinh nghiệm của tôi nêu ra rằng chính 1 số đoạn code đơn giản và có logic luôn luôn hoạt động hết sức tốt, kết quả thu đc thường mắc hết sức ít lỗi và có nhiều trình độ mở rộng. Tôi từng nghe được một câu nói hết sức hay đối với phạm trù công Thực trạng lập trình, ấy là:Đoạn code tốt thì chính bản thân nó đã là một sổ sách tuyệt vời rồi. Bởi thế mỗi lúc mọi người chuẩn bị viết thêm một dòng chú thích thì cần tự hỏi cá nhân trước rằng “Làm Bí quyết nào mà tôi có thể cải tiến đoạn code đó để không cần phải bổ sung loại chú thích này nữa nhỉ?” – Steve McConnell.
    5. các bạn có thể dành cao hơn thời gian để phân tích hạn chế thì sẽ giúp các bạn tốn ít thời gian để sữa chữa lỗi
    mọi người hãy dành nhiều thời hạn hơn để hiểu, phân tích thấu đáo quan ngại và thiết kế phương án cho nó. bạn sẽ nhận thấy phần Thực trạng còn lại chỉ bao gồm 1 số thứ tương đối dễ học . Việc thiết kế ko phải khi nào cũng là dùng vài ngôn ngữ mô hình hóa hay công cụ gì cao siêu, có đôi lúc chỉ cần mọi người ngẩng nhìn lên bầu trời xanh và ý nghĩ về phương án cho bài toán ấy ở trong tâm trí. 1 số người có thói quen lao vào thiết kế code hùng hục ngay khi vừa nhận được yêu cầu thì thường làm ra kết quả là một cái gì ấy khác xa so cùng với yêu cầu thực tiễn nhất.